文档章节

JeeSite 4.0 规划(一)

ThinkGem
 ThinkGem
发布于 2017/05/30 21:27
字数 632
阅读 15415
收藏 24
点赞 23
评论 34

时隔3年,偶得OSC举办的2016最优秀的开源项目之一,让Gem兴奋了一下,也再次燃起了对JeeSite升级的强烈欲望。感谢OSC提供码云这么好的平台,感谢红薯大哥的亲笔祝福!

很抱歉,由于近年来工作原因比较忙,JeeSite得到的是极少维护,在这样的情况下,依然得到了大家的深深青睐,这让Gem感到非常羞愧,在此忠诚感谢您们的鼓励和支持,否则也没有JeeSite的今天。

JeeSite自开源以来被用到了企业、政府、医疗、金融、互联网等各个领域中,JeeSite的设计思想和开发模式也深入支持者的内心,也帮助了不少刚毕业的大学生去快速学习和实践。这次升级的规划Gem也结合了以往的经验和总结各方面的应用案例,对架构做一次全部重构,也纳入一些新的思想。从开发者模式、底层架构、逻辑处理到用户界面都有很大的进步,最重要的是安全稳定,降低学习成本,提高开发效率。

由于时代的变革,技术的演变,这次规划架构的变化很大,所以将不考虑之前版本的兼容。既然有了规划,就的去实现,在不影响正常工作的情况下,所有计划均安排在本人业余时间,这样也就意味着,我会牺牲掉业余时间去学习新的知识。话说回来,规划结果也是我非常期待的,可以把我近年来的一个个的想法,一个个的目标,在这里实现。由于时间上不能保证,也很抱歉不能给大家一个准确的公布时间,如果大家有什么建议,可在此留言。

关于开源许可,目前孪生产品或直接拿来改名销售的太多,有可理解的也不可理解,在这里不说太多了,也不发表什么看法,总之新版Licence应该会有下变更,从之前的开源协议ALv2变更为GPLv3或AGPL,核心代码暂不开放,不影响二次开发。

关于版本号,感谢江南白衣大哥的springside4对我的启发和帮助很大,所以4作为jeesite的第二个里程碑版本号。

规划内容,见下文  https://my.oschina.net/thinkgem/blog/913777

© 著作权归作者所有

共有 人打赏支持
ThinkGem

ThinkGem

粉丝 856
博文 135
码字总数 20086
作品 1
济南
架构师
加载中

评论(34)

尋找大馒头
尋找大馒头
开放给地址,一起搞
zhangfazhen
zhangfazhen
支持!
凡羊羊
凡羊羊
期待,也可以偶尔来个pull requests:wink:
zyxcba
zyxcba
:+1::thumbsup:
很拽De土豆
很拽De土豆
我说怎么感觉和springside这么像。原来也是受到它的影响哈。好久没更新了,我都以为作者不维护了,喜欢折腾的程序员都不错~
akak
akak
支持
學無止境
學無止境
支持...点赞
summervibe
summervibe
确实刚毕业就在工作中用的框架,很实用:+1:
fundyliu
fundyliu
赞一个,支持到底
c
charlesduan
不错
jeesite v4.0.2 版本多数据源配置问题

现在项目管理后台想用jeesite4.0,需要支持多数据源配置。自己配置了一天也不好使。请问有做过类似的同学分享下经验。感激不尽。最好能有详细的配置步骤。谢谢了

crazyYXD ⋅ 05/04 ⋅ 0

JeeSite 4.0.2 发布,企业级快速开发平台

新增 新增:支持分布式事务,多数据源下事务支持 新增:支持MyBatisDao注解指定数据源名称,Dao层动态切换数据源 新增:国际化底层框架、通用组件、机构管理功能和代码生成模板 新增:Linux...

ThinkGem ⋅ 04/22 ⋅ 0

jeesite启动服务时候报错,前边都是按步骤做的,请问问什么会有这样的错误

2018-05-12 21:25:04,551 ERROR [activiti.engine.impl.db.DbSqlSession] - problem during schema create, statement create table ACT_GE_PROPERTY ( NAME_ varchar(64), VALUE_ varchar(3......

cxls ⋅ 05/12 ⋅ 0

企业信息化快速开发平台--JeeSite

JeeSite是基于多个优秀的开源项目,高度整合封装而成的高效,高性能,强安全性的 开源 Java EE快速开发平台。 JeeSite本身是以Spring Framework为核心容器,Spring MVC为模型视图控制器,MyB...

thinkgem ⋅ 2013/02/24 ⋅ 49

企业信息化快速开发平台JeeSite

平台简介 JeeSite是基于多个优秀的开源项目,高度整合封装而成的高效,高性能,强安全性的开源Java EE快速开发平台。 JeeSite本身是以Spring Framework为核心容器,Spring MVC为模型视图控制...

boonya ⋅ 2016/07/11 ⋅ 1

WellGroup/jeewell

jeewell: jeewell是开源的JavaEE开发平台,集成流行的开发框架,采用MVC的分层设计思想, 为JavaEE开发这提供一个安全、高效的开发模式,目前的版本为0.9.8,功能正在逐步完善中。 开发环境...

WellGroup ⋅ 2016/07/07 ⋅ 0

中国联通备战5G MWC发布《Edge-Cloud平台架构及产业生态白皮书》

2月26日-3月1日,中国联通受邀参加2018MWC世界移动通信大会,作为本次大会GSMA智慧城市展区参展的唯一中国运营商,中国联通提出以服务为驱动的面向5G网络切片的演进思路,为客户提供4G到5G演...

玄学酱 ⋅ 02/27 ⋅ 0

maven 注册 jar

maven 注册 jar 一. sqlserver怎么添加jar到maven sqljdbc是微软sql server的jdbc驱动 使用sqljdbc需要从微软的官方网站下载jar包: http://www.microsoft.com/en-us/download/details.aspx...

小南风 ⋅ 2016/09/05 ⋅ 0

jeesite框架思维导图

工欲善其事,必先利其器!工匠想要使他的工作做好,一定要先让工具锋利。要做好一件事,准备工作非常重要。刚刚接触jeesite,觉得还不错,可其技术涉及 1、后端 核心框架:Spring Framework ...

zerov ⋅ 2016/06/27 ⋅ 7

jeesite 框架搭建与配置

jeesite 框架搭建与配置 一、搭建环境: https://github.com/thinkgem/jeesite 过程中如果报错,一般是maven配置的问题,百度一般都可以解决~ 执行完成后提示:BUILD SUCCESSS!即可,过程中...

风中帆 ⋅ 2016/10/27 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

Yii2中findAll()的正确使用姿势/返回为空的处理办法

从一次错误的操作开始 $buildingObject = Building::findAll("status=1"); 1 这个调用看着没有任何毛病,但是在使用时返回的结果却是一个空数组。再回过头来看看数据表中: 按照套路来讲,查...

dragon_tech ⋅ 今天 ⋅ 0

如何优雅的编程——C语言界面的一点小建议

我们鼓励在编程时应有清晰的哲学思维,而不是给予硬性规则。我并不希望你们能认可所有的东西,因为它们只是观点,观点会随着时间的变化而变化。可是,如果不是直到现在把它们写在纸上,长久以...

柳猫 ⋅ 今天 ⋅ 0

从零手写 IOC容器

概述 IOC (Inversion of Control) 控制反转。熟悉Spring的应该都知道。那么具体是怎么实现的呢?下面我们通过一个例子说明。 1. Component注解定义 package cn.com.qunar.annotation;impo...

轨迹_ ⋅ 今天 ⋅ 0

系统健康检查利器-Spring Boot-Actuator

前言 实例由于出现故障、部署或自动缩放的情况,会进行持续启动、重新启动或停止操作。它可能导致它们暂时或永久不可用。为避免问题,您的负载均衡器应该从路由中跳过不健康的实例,因为它们...

harries ⋅ 今天 ⋅ 0

手把手教你搭建vue-cli脚手架-详细步骤图文解析[vue入门]

写在前面: 使用 vue-cli 可以快速创建 vue 项目,vue-cli很好用,但是在最初搭建环境安装vue-cli及相关内容的时候,对一些人来说是很头疼的一件事情,本人在搭建vue-cli的项目环境的时候也是...

韦姣敏 ⋅ 今天 ⋅ 0

12c rman中输入sql命令

12c之前版本,要在rman中执行sql语句,必须使用sql "alter system switch logfile"; 而在12c版本中,可以支持大量的sql语句了: 比如: C:\Users\zhengquan>rman target / 恢复管理器: Release 1...

tututu_jiang ⋅ 今天 ⋅ 0

Nginx的https配置记录以及http强制跳转到https的方法梳理

Nginx的https配置记录以及http强制跳转到https的方法梳理 一、Nginx安装(略) 安装的时候需要注意加上 --with-httpsslmodule,因为httpsslmodule不属于Nginx的基本模块。 Nginx安装方法: ...

Yomut ⋅ 今天 ⋅ 0

SpringCloud Feign 传递复杂参数对象需要注意的地方

1.传递复杂参数对象需要用Post,另外需要注意,Feign不支持使用GetMapping 和PostMapping @RequestMapping(value="user/save",method=RequestMethod.POST) 2.在传递的过程中,复杂对象使用...

@林文龙 ⋅ 今天 ⋅ 0

如何显示 word 左侧目录大纲

打开word说明文档,如下图,我们发现左侧根本就没有目录,给我们带来很大的阅读障碍 2 在word文档的头部菜单栏中,切换到”视图“选项卡 3 然后勾选“导航窗格”选项 4 我们会惊奇的发现左侧...

二营长意大利炮 ⋅ 今天 ⋅ 0

智能合约编程语言Solidity之线上开发工具

工具地址:https://ethereum.github.io/browser-solidity/ 实例实验: 1.创建hello.sol文件 2.调试输出结果

硅谷课堂 ⋅ 今天 ⋅ 0

没有更多内容

加载失败,请刷新页面

加载更多

下一页

返回顶部
顶部